Многие владельцы смартфонов сталкиваются с проблемой нехватки внутренней памяти, особенно если устройство имеет бюджетные характеристики. Встроенный накопитель быстро заполняется фотографиями, видеозаписями и тяжелыми играми, что приводит к торможению системы. Решением этой проблемы часто становится использование внешнего накопителя, но не все пользователи знают, как правильно распределить данные.
Перенос приложений на SD-карту позволяет освободить значительный объем внутреннего хранилища без потери функциональности мобильных программ. Однако этот процесс имеет свои особенности в зависимости от версии операционной системы Android и модели устройства. Не все приложения поддерживают перенос, а некоторые системные утилиты останутся на месте навсегда.
Готовим карту памяти и телефон к работе
Прежде чем начинать перемещение программ, необходимо убедиться, что внешний накопитель готов к интенсивной работе. Обычные карты памяти могут не выдержать нагрузки от постоянных обращений к файлам приложений, что приведет к их быстрому выходу из строя. Выбирайте носители с высоким классом скорости.
Вставьте карту в слот устройства и дождитесь, пока система определит её. Зайдите в раздел Настройки → Хранилище и проверьте, распознается ли диск. Если карта новая, её необходимо отформатировать, но не забудьте заранее сохранить все важные данные с неё на компьютер, так как форматирование удалит всю информацию.
Для корректной работы рекомендуется выбрать режим использования карты как «Внутреннее хранилище» или «Портативный носитель» в зависимости от ваших целей. При выборе первого варианта карта будет зашифрована и станет частью системного накопителя, что удобно для переноса данных, но сделает её нечитаемой на других устройствах.
⚠️ Внимание: Если вы выберете форматирование как «Внутреннее хранилище», карта памяти перестанет работать на других телефонах без повторного форматирования. Это критически важный момент, который нужно учесть перед началом настройки.
⚠️ Внимание: Используйте карты памяти стандарта UHS-I или выше, иначе запуск тяжелых игр с внешнего накопителя может вызывать вылеты и зависания интерфейса.
Убедитесь, что на карте есть свободное место, превышающее размер переносимых приложений минимум в два раза для обеспечения стабильной работы кэша.
☑️ Подготовка к переносу
Способы переноса через настройки системы
Самый простой и безопасный метод перемещения программ доступен через стандартное меню настроек. Этот способ работает на многих устройствах, хотя интерфейс может незначительно отличаться в зависимости от производителя: Samsung, Xiaomi, Huawei.
Перейдите в Настройки → Приложения и выберите список установленных программ. Нажмите на ту утилиту, которую хотите перенести. В открывшемся окне найдите пункт «Хранилище» или «Память». Если кнопка «Изменить» или «Перенести» активна, нажмите её и выберите карту памяти из списка доступных накопителей.
Если кнопка неактивна (серая), значит разработчик приложения запретил его перемещение, или версия Android не поддерживает эту функцию для выбранной программы. В этом случае придется искать альтернативные методы или пользоваться встроенным менеджером памяти, который автоматически переносит наименее используемые приложения.
Использование ADB для принудительного переноса
Если стандартные настройки не позволяют переместить нужное приложение, можно попробовать использовать отладку по USB и команду ADB. Этот метод требует включения специальных опций разработчика и подключения смартфона к компьютеру. Он подходит для продвинутых пользователей, готовых экспериментировать с системными файлами.
Сначала включите «Отладку по USB» в меню для разработчиков. Подключите телефон к ПК, откройте командную строку и введите команду для проверки подключения: adb devices. Если устройство определено, можно использовать команду для переноса конкретного пакета:
pm move-package имя_пакета sdcard. Эта команда принудительно перемещает приложение на внешний накопитель.
Внимание: Неправильное использование ADB может привести к потере данных или нестабильной работе системы. Всегда делайте резервную копию перед экспериментами.
После ввода команды система может запросить подтверждение или показать статус процесса. Если все прошло успешно, приложение исчезнет из внутреннего хранилища и появится в разделе SD-карты. Однако не все утилиты поддаются такому управлению, так как разработчики могут блокировать это на уровне кода.
⚠️ Внимание: При использовании метода ADB существует риск повреждения системных файлов, если команда введена неверно. Действуйте осторожно и только с приложениями, в которых уверены.
Что такое ADB?|ADB (Android Debug Bridge) — это инструмент командной строки, который позволяет вам общаться с устройством. Он используется для установки приложений, отладки и выполнения системных команд, недоступных в обычном интерфейсе.-->
Нюансы работы с форматированием как внутреннего хранилища
Современные версии Android предлагают функцию «Adoptable Storage», которая позволяет объединить внутреннюю память и карту памяти в один виртуальный диск. Это самый эффективный способ, так как система сама решает, где хранить данные, и приложение можно перенести автоматически.
Чтобы активировать эту функцию, зайдите в Настройки → Хранилище → SD-карта и выберите «Настройки» (иконка шестеренки). Нажмите «Форматировать как внутреннюю память». После этого телефон предложит перенести часть данных на карту. Процесс может занять несколько десятков минут.
Обратите внимание, что после форматирования карта памяти будет зашифрована конкретным устройством. Вы не сможете просто вынуть её и вставить в другой телефон или компьютер для чтения файлов. Это сделано для безопасности данных, но снижает гибкость использования.
Если вы решите отформатировать карту обратно в «Портативный носитель», все перенесенные приложения будут удалены. Поэтому данный метод подходит только тем, кто готов пожертвовать универсальностью карты ради свободного места.
Настройки → Хранилище → SD-карта и выберите «Настройки» (иконка шестеренки). Нажмите «Форматировать как внутреннюю память». После этого телефон предложит перенести часть данных на карту. Процесс может занять несколько десятков минут.